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/jquery/77.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
同一web应用程序的多个用户使用MySQL和PHP进行实时屏幕更新_Php_Jquery_Mysql_Ajax_Html - Fatal编程技术网

同一web应用程序的多个用户使用MySQL和PHP进行实时屏幕更新

同一web应用程序的多个用户使用MySQL和PHP进行实时屏幕更新,php,jquery,mysql,ajax,html,Php,Jquery,Mysql,Ajax,Html,甚至弄清楚如何问这个问题都很困难,所以就这样吧 我有一个基本的web应用程序,它(过于简化)获取名称,将它们添加到html表中,并将它们输入到MySQL数据库表中。这是使用PHP/Ajax/jQuery类型编码以非常传统的方式完成的,并在不刷新屏幕的情况下显示新条目 我现在对并发类型的问题不感兴趣。我需要知道的是如何在不刷新屏幕的情况下,在其他人的页面上显示一个人在其网页中所做的更新 因此,如果我和Jim都在同一个web应用程序上,但在不同的物理位置,并且我在表中添加了一个名称,我希望该名称也立

甚至弄清楚如何问这个问题都很困难,所以就这样吧

我有一个基本的web应用程序,它(过于简化)获取名称,将它们添加到html表中,并将它们输入到MySQL数据库表中。这是使用PHP/Ajax/jQuery类型编码以非常传统的方式完成的,并在不刷新屏幕的情况下显示新条目

我现在对并发类型的问题不感兴趣。我需要知道的是如何在不刷新屏幕的情况下,在其他人的页面上显示一个人在其网页中所做的更新

因此,如果我和Jim都在同一个web应用程序上,但在不同的物理位置,并且我在表中添加了一个名称,我希望该名称也立即出现在他的屏幕上。当然,如果他加上一个名字,我也想马上在我的屏幕上看到它

我希望在没有完全刷新屏幕的情况下执行此操作


这是如何做到的?

就像stackoverflow/facebook通知在没有页面刷新的情况下是如何实现的一样。我说的对吗,基思·D?你试过什么?你的示例代码在哪里?你看过这个方法了吗?这似乎就是你想要的!基本上,当用户2更改Web表时,您必须让页面接收通知,然后调用一个函数,该函数只更新作为用户1显示在工作表中的值。我不太确定第二部分,因为我不确定是否可以用php实现这一点-您可能需要考虑使用不同的语言来实现这一点!希望这有帮助:)099当我甚至不知道如何开始做的时候,我怎么能给出示例代码呢?@Jason-虽然不会有即时更新(除非你每秒都请求服务器,这可能有点过分!)。COMET方法是Facebook用来给你发送通知的方法,非常酷,非常优雅!